We will need a van as we have 5 people Thanks I don't believe there are any rental agencies at the dock. You would need to be shuttled to a rental location either near the port (port area hotels) or to the Ft. Lauderdale airport. The drive to Orlando is about 4-5 hours depending on traffic.
